十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
1、双击就是两次单机,当点击事件出发时按下的时候出发一次onTouch 事件,抬起的时候,也触发一个onTouch 事件。如果想做双击的话 只能自己进行判断了,用两次onTouch 抬起时的时间间隔来定位他是否是双击。
专注于为中小企业提供网站建设、网站设计服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业瓜州免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了近千家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。
2、用来判定该次点击是SingleTap而不是DoubleTap,如果连续点击两次就是DoubleTap手势,如果只点击一次,系统等待一段时间后没有收到第二次点击则判定该次点击为SingleTap而不是DoubleTap,然后触发SingleTapConfirmed事件。
3、首先打开华为手机,点击打开华为手机设置中的“智能辅助”。然后在弹出来的窗口中点击打开“手势控制”选项。然后在弹出来的窗口中点击打开“双击唤醒与关闭屏幕”。
4、只能重启平板电脑。按电源及音量+键不放半分钟。显示技术信息界面里选重启项。
5、,按下述操作:进入 设置---语言和输入法---在“键盘和输入法”中点击“默认”(黑体字)---点击“中文拼音--谷歌拼音输入法”。此操作是将默认更改为“中文拼音--谷歌拼音输入法”。
作用 : View类的performClick和callOnclick函数都可以实现,不用用户手动点击,直接触发View的点击事件。
在你的布局文件中,为两个按钮分别添加唯一的ID。在你的Activity或Fragment中,找到这两个按钮的引用并设置点击事件监听器。
第一种方式就是:调用performClick事件 这种方式很简单,但是有一个弊端,就是不会传递触摸点坐标,只是模拟一下btn2的点击事件。
Down事件时,会调用一个checkForLongClick方法,向主线程延迟发送一个Runnable。
两种方法实现:把button 的 Onclick 实现的功能封装成一个方法,当到达阈值时候不通过button。 而是直接调用你封装好的方法来实现和点击button同样的效果。使用Button Api中的performClick();方法来实现模拟点击button。
api上说,如果view注册了touch事件,则有可能会影响这个控件的onClick事件。为了解决和单击事件冲突: 要给view注册touch事件。 在touch中增加 case MotionEvent.ACTION_UP: 调用一下view.performClick();。
1、Android判断屏幕有没有触碰,可以通过OnTouch事件来判断。当用户触摸了屏幕就会执行onTouch事件。 在Activity中重写onTouchEvent方法。 在public boolean onTouchEvent(android.view.MotionEvent event) 中用变量记录即可。
2、首先,支持长按和点击的视图一定是从Down开始就消费事件,在不设置Touch监听器OnTouchListener的情况下,每个事件都会进入onTouchEvent方法。当一个视图设置了长按监听器,在Flag中会增加LONG_CLICKABLE标志。
3、(3)setOnDoubleTapListener(GestureDetector.OnDoubleTapListener onDoubleTapListener) 设置双击监听器 使用 流程: 首先,系统捕捉屏幕的触摸事件(onTouchListener),这时还未涉及具体手势,只是简单地捕捉到触摸。
1、RadioButton是单选按钮,允许用户在一个组中选择一个选项。同一组中的单选按钮有互斥效果。
2、设置一个全局变量为RadioButton的状态,设置RadioButton点击监听事件,监听你是否点击按钮,如果按钮是点击状态,那再次点击后就会取消选中。
3、如下图:显示文字效果我们知道在Android开发中向RadioGroup中添加多个RadioButton,可以实现多个选项中只有一个RadioButton选中的效果,但在JetpackCompose中没有这样的实现,我们需要自己自定义一个组合。
4、做2个radiobutton 一个选中 一个不选中 一个显示 一个隐藏 点了显示选中的 再先就显示没选中的那个 JS就可以实现了。
1、找到手机设置,点击进入到时设置页面,如图所示。进入设置之后,点击关于手机选项,如图所示。在关于手机的页面中,找到版本号,并连续点击多次版本号,直到出现开发人员选项为止。
2、可以使用Service运行,sevice就是在后台运行的进程。
3、通过android的四大组件之一的service来实现后台运行,类似Windows上的服务。Android上的service有两种启动方式(或者说两种方法实现service)①startService()和bindService() ,有区别。
4、首先要保证你的程序一直在于后台运行,也就是所谓和守护程序一样,而且在任何认为kill和系统内存回收kill后,保证重启。获取系统内部资源。上报策略,间隔时间上报还是按月按天上报。